Josef Strauss Ed: David Heyes . Scored for 3 Violins (or 2 Violins & Viola) and Double Bass (or Cello). Josef Strauss was arguably the most talented of the Strauss dynasty, although his brother Johann was certainly the most successful. The Jockey Polka was composed in 1870,was one of Josef's last compositions, and is a fast and lively polka which is full of fun, rhythmic energy and great forward momentum. It is playable by a variety of string quartets and is evocative of the dance music of the 19th-century. Easy for the bassist, but full of high spirits and always successful in performance..
